Rich Robertson (right-handed pitcher)
Richard Paul Robertson is a former Major League Baseball pitcher. He pitched six seasons in the major leagues, from 1966 until 1971, all for the San Francisco Giants. In 1970, he led the National League in wild pitches with 18.
